As verbs, break up is a hyponym of fall apart; that is, break up is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than fall apart:
  • fall apart: become separated into pieces or fragments
  • break up: break or cause to break into pieces
Other hyponyms of fall apart include break open, burst, split, puncture, burst, bust, smash, ladder, run, crack, snap, fragment, fragmentise, fragmentize, crush.
